Have you ever felt like you don't make enough milk? This is something so many moms worry about. It's a topic discussed frequently in breastfeeding support groups. I wrote a post bringing up some of the concerns I've heard related to milk production with helpful links that provide evidence based answers here- http://latchedonmom.blogspot.com/2013/04/do-i-make-enough-milk-for-baby.html
Now, there are definitely times where a mother may experience a decrease in milk output, stress, hormones and dehydration are the most likely reasons you may experience this. Moms who have little ones who cannot or will not nurse and rely on a pump, or return to work and have to pump also can face a struggle with milk production. I have never had good luck getting enough milk from exclusively pumping. I've pumped 8 times a day, 30 minutes or more per session and still couldn't cut it. I'd get less than 30 ounces when my baby (with her slow flow, paced feedings) required to eat 5-10 more ounces daily.

    1. Please take a moment to personally evaluate the risks associated with the medications prescribed to you, as many times when doctors just aren't sure they say to pump and dump. This is not always needed! Here's the best places to check-
      LactMed http://toxnet.nlm.nih.gov/cgi-bin/sis/htmlgen?LACT
      Dr. Hales Infant Risk Center- http://www.infantrisk.org/
